切换触控板采样速率的方法及装置的制作方法

文档序号:6626119阅读:127来源:国知局
专利名称:切换触控板采样速率的方法及装置的制作方法
技术领域
本发明涉及计算机领域,特别是涉及一种切换触控板采样速率的方法及装置。
背景技术
目前笔记本电脑日趋普及,越来越小巧,操作也越来越简单方便,但是一般情况下,对与笔记本电脑都会另外单独配一个便携式鼠标通过数据接口(比如USB接口)连接在电脑上进行工作,或用无线鼠标进行操作,以满足用户不同的需求,而一般情况下不使用笔记本电脑自带的触控板。但是,无论是使用外带的鼠标还是自身的触控板,在不同的应用环境下,切换鼠标或触控板的采样速率比较麻烦,更何况不知怎样来操作,更害怕进入操作而损坏笔记本电脑。因此,在不同的工作环境下,不能满足用户的需求。比如,当利用笔记本电脑来编写文档时,其触控板的采样速率达到60报告/秒,才能达到最佳的使用效果;而当利用笔记本电脑来玩游戏时,其触控板的采样速率只有达到200报告/秒时,才能使用户玩的比较爽快和过瘾。但是,如果向满足用户的需求,必须进行触控板速率的切换,怎样能快速地将触控板的采样速率从60报告/秒调整200报告/秒呢,这对于技术人员来说,虽然步骤复杂,但还可以调节地,而对于不熟悉的用户来说会感觉到操作很繁琐,而降低了用户的满意度。
另外,由于笔记本电脑受制于体积的大小,在目前的电脑上很难再增加接口来控制采样速率的调整,越来越多的外设设备还要占据更多的接口,这无形之间增加了笔记本电脑之间的成本费用;而且连接外置鼠标不利于携带,如果在空间小的情况下,鼠标也很难摆放。在每台笔记本都配有触控板的情况下,用户由于都感受操作不方便,需要的工作速率和实际操作相差很大,对普通使用者要改变其切换的采样速率而感觉到非常复杂,更不清楚在哪里可以调整触控板的采样速率,而影响用户的感受度。
目前,传统的笔记本电脑中切换触控板采样速率的方法的流程图,详见图1,所述方法包括步骤当用户需要切换触控板的采样速率时,需执行以下步骤步骤F11用户用右键选者我的电脑;步骤F12单击属性;步骤F13在硬件菜单下单击设备管理器;步骤F14单击鼠标和其他指针设备;步骤F15单击touchpad;步骤F16单击高级设置;步骤F17在采样速率里选择所需要的采样速率。
由此可见,现有技术所述切换触控板采样速率的方法,在普通的OS里操作起来比较复杂,工作效率有待提高,这是由于切换采样速率的操作步骤比较多,每次更改都比教麻烦,而且用户无法识别当前触控板的工作状态。对于对系统不熟悉的用户会感觉操作很繁琐,影响用户的使用感受;普通用户不能根据当前的工作环境来调整触控板的采样速率,以满足不同工作状态的需求。

发明内容
本发明解决的技术问题是提供一种切换触控板采样速率的方法及装置,其实现简单,且能够方便的调节触控板的采样速率。
为解决上述问题,本发明提供一种切换触控板采样速率的方法,包括以下步骤A、存储可供用户选择的触控板的采样速率;B、检测触控板所能支持的所有采样速率;C、接收用户对触控板的采样速率进行选择,并输入选择信息;D、对用户选择的触控板的采样速率与当前触控板所支持的采样速率进行比较,如果能够支持用户的选择,则进入步骤E;否则,则输出当前触控板的采样速率,并返回步骤C;E、根据选定触控板的采样速率,调整触控板的相关属性;F、返回调整后的信息,完成触控板采样速率的切换。
所述步骤B中结合触控板的驱动、接口以及底层驱动,识别触控板参数,来检测触控板所能支持的所有采样速率;所述步骤E中通过调用触控板驱动,修改参数值来调整触控板的相关属性;所述步骤E中通过底层驱动识别,将所述调整后的信息反馈到系统。
所述步骤C中接收用户通过点击采样速率下拉菜单产生的输入信息或者是通过快捷键发送的选择指令来接收用户对触控板的采样速率。
步骤B还包括接收用户启动采样速率调节的信息,显示供用户选择的采样速率。
接收用户使用快捷键通过嵌入式控制器发出的扫描码来启动采样速率调节的信息。
所述显示供用户选择的采样速率的显示过程包括比较所述存储的采样速率和当前触控板所支持的采样速率,显示出允许调节的采样速率。
另外,本发明还提供一种切换触控板采样速率的装置,包括用户信息接收单元,用于接收用户启动采样速率调节过程的信息和用户选择采样速率的信息;采样速率识别单元,与用户信息接收单元相连,用于获取当前触控板驱动支持的采样数率;调整信息返回单元,用于向系统返回选定的触控板的采样速率;采样速率存储单元,用于存储可供用户选择使用的触控板采样速率状态;采样速率显示单元,与用户信息接收单元和采样速率存储单元分别相连,用于显示供用户选择的触控板的采样速率;采样速率比较单元,与用户信息接收单元相连,用于对用户选择的采样速率与触控板能够支持的采样速率进行比较;采样速率调整单元,与采样速率比较单元和调整信息返回单元分别相连,用于在选定的触控板的采样速率下,调节触控板的工作属性。
所述采样速率存储单元、采样速率显示单元、采样速率比较单元、采样速率调整单元是分立的器件;或者至少两个单元集成在一起。
所述采样速率存储单元、采样速率显示单元、采样速率比较单元、采样速率调整单元是内含固化软件的芯片,或者是运行在笔记本电脑的软件模块。
所述用户信息接收单元是嵌入式控制器;所述采样速率识别单元包括触控板驱动;所述调整信息返回单元是底层驱动。
与现有技术相比,本发明具有以下有益效果由于本发明能够自动检测触控板支持的采样速率,与用户的选择进行比较来确定合适的采样速率,在确定采样速率后,能够调节该触控板采样速率下的较佳采样速率,很方便的适应不同的工作方式和使用环境,方便用户的使用。因此,本发明实现较为简单,用户只需要较为简单的直接操作(例如采用“一键”或“组合键”的方式来切换)即可完成对触控板采样速率的调整,无需掌握复杂的有关操作系统的知识,给用户提供更加丰富多彩的使用体验和方便。能够使使用用户明确当前触控板的采样速率,根据不同任务调整触控板不同的采样速率,尽可能满足用户在不同应用模式下的需求,以增强用户的良好感受度。另外,本发明由于采用按键切换,用户可以在看不到或看不清楚显示的情况下完成触控板全部的切换动作。


图1是现有技术中切换触控板采样速率的方法的流程图;图2是本发明切换触控板采样速率的方法的流程图;
图3是本发明方法中用户操作的示意图;图4是本发明切换触控板采样速率的装置的示意图;图5是本发明切换触控板采样速率的装置的实施例的示意图;图6是图5所示实施例的工作原理图。
具体实施例方式
本发明应用于笔记本电脑以调节其上触控板的采样速率。本发明在笔记本电脑运行的情况下,根据用户的需要可以利用简单的操作完成触控板采样速率的调整,使笔记本电脑可以很方便的适应不同的工作方式和使用环境,方便用户的使用,提高用户的感受度。
下面结合附图对本发明作进一步的说明。
请参阅图2,为本发明切换触控板采样速率的方法的流程图,所述方法包括以下步骤步骤M10存储可供用户选择的触控板的采样速率;步骤M11检测触控板所能支持的所有采样速率;步骤M12接收用户对触控板的采样速率进行选择,并输入选择信息;步骤M13对用户选择的触控板的采样速率与当前触控板所支持的采样速率进行比较,如果能够支持用户的选择,则进入步骤M14;否则,则输出当前触控板的采样速率(步骤M16),并返回步骤M12;步骤M14根据选定触控板的采样速率,调整触控板的相关属性;步骤M15返回调整后的信息,完成触控板采样速率的切换。
其中,步骤M11与步骤M12之间的先后顺序可以根据实际情况进行调整,也可以同时进行。
本发明通过上述步骤对笔记本电脑的触控板的采样速率进行调整,以达到所述触控板的采样速率在不同工作环境下进行快捷切换,使采样速率调整到最佳效果,以满足客户的在不同应用模式下对触控板的不同要求,从而增强用户的感受度。
本发明所述触控板采样速率的切换过程中,快捷键程序先存储不同工作模式下触控板所支持用的采样速率,当用户需要更换工作模式时或切换触控板的采样数率时,启动触控板驱动自动检测所述触控板所支持的采样速率,并显示出所检测到的采样数率供用户选择。也就说接收用户使用快捷键通过嵌入式控制器发出的扫描码来检测触控板所支持的采样数率,并比较所述存储的采样速率和当前触控板所支持的采样速率,显示出允许调节的采样速率。用户根据所允许调节的采样数率进行选择,即接收用户点击采样速率下拉菜单,并输入所需采样数率信息或者是接收用户通过快捷键发送的选择指令来选取采样数率。当操作系统(OS)接收到输入信息或指令时,将触控板的采样速率调整到用户所选定的采样速率;返回调整后的信息,完成触控板采样速率的切换,也就是说通过底层驱动(Driver)识别,将所述信息反馈到系统,所述用户已切换到所选择的工作模式状态下运作。
还请参考图3,为本发明所述切换方法中用户操作的示意图;在本发明所述的流程中,对于用户来说,需要进行的操作仅为以下两个步骤步骤N10调用触控板采样速率调整菜单,即启动触控板采样速率的调节过程,调出触控板采样速率的调整菜单;步骤N11选择需要的触控板的采样速率,即进行触控板采样速率的选择,输入选择信息。其余的步骤则由笔记本电脑自动来完成。
另外,本发明还提供一种切换触控板采样速率的装置,其结构示意图详见图4。所述装置包括用户信息接收单元11、采样速率存储单元12、采样速率显示单元13、采样速率识别单元14、采样速率比较单元15、采样速率调整单元16和调整信息返回单元17。
其中,所述用户信息接收单元11,用于接收用户启动采样速率调节的信息和用户对采样速率的选择信息。
所述采样速率存储单元12,用于存储可供用户选择使用的触控板采样速率的状态。
所述采样速率显示单元13,与所述用户信息接收单元11和采样速率存储单元12分别相连,用于在采样速率调节过程时显示可供用户选择的触控板的采样速率。
所述采样速率识别单元14,与采样速率显示单元13相连,用于在采样速率调节过程时检测当前触控板所能支持的采样速率。
所述采样速率比较单元15,与用户信息接收单元11相连,用于对用户选择的采样速率与触控板能够支持的采样速率进行比较。
所述采样速率调整单元16,与采样速率比较单元15相连,用于在选定的触控板的采样速率下,用户选择完成后,通过嵌入式控制器调整采样速率。
所述调整信息返回单元17与采样速率调整单元16相连,用于反馈最终的调节信息,完成触控板的采样速率的切换。
其中,所述采样速率存储单元、采样速率显示单元、采样速率比较单元、采样速率调整单元是分立的器件;或者至少两个单元集成在一起。所述采样速率存储单元、采样速率显示单元、采样速率比较单元、采样速率调整单元是内含固化软件的芯片,或者是运行在笔记本电脑中的软件模块。
为更好地理解本发明,下面结合实施例对本发明进行介绍。
请参阅图5,为本发明切换触控板采样速率的装置的实施例的示意图。在笔记本电脑中包括快捷程序模块21,所述快捷程序模块21中存储可供用户选择的触控板的采样速率。所述快捷程序模块21接收嵌入式控制器22(EC)发出的指令和数据,进行相应的处理;所述快捷程序模块21还可以与触控板的驱动进行数据交互。其实现原理为快捷键接收到嵌入式控制器下发的控制指令时,运行快捷程序模块,调用触控板驱动23,完成采样速率的切换。
还请参阅图6,为图5所示实施例的工作原理图。其工作原理为
步骤H10快捷键程序模块存储不同模式下触控板的采样速率;在安装快捷程序模块21时,将实际应用模式需要的触控板采样速率状态(如打游戏时,触控板采样速率需要200报告/秒时,才能玩的爽快,而进行文档操作时采样速率只需要60报告/秒,就能达到良好的效果,在一般情况下触控板的采样速率为100报告/秒等)存储在系统中,快捷程序模块21存储不同模式下触控板所需的采样速率;步骤H11点击快捷键,启动快捷程序模块;即用户使用快捷键通过嵌入式控制器22调用操作系统(OS)下的快捷程序模块21;步骤H12触控板驱动和底层连接,检测出触控板支持的采样速率;即快捷程序模块21结合触控板的驱动和接口,以及底层驱动,对触控板的采样速率进行侦测;通过快捷程序模块21存储的自动检测出触控板所有支持的采样速率;步骤H13显示出允许调节采样速率的菜单,并进行采样速率的选择,即显示触控板允许调节的采样速率的菜单,用户进行触控板采样速率的选择(选择具体可以是用户点击采样速率下拉菜单产生输入信息或者是用户通过快捷键发送选择指令);步骤H14选择速率后,通过Driver识别,将相关信息反馈到系统,将触控板的采样速率调整为用户所需的采样速率;即选定在现实中支持的用户需要的触控板采样速率,快捷程序模块21调用触控板驱动23,检测相应的值,进行触控板采样速率的调整用户所需的采样速率。
以上的操作均为快捷程序模块结合EC和触控板驱动自动进行,对于用户来说需要进行的操作仅为以下两部使用快捷键,调出触控板采样速率调整的菜单;进行触控板采样速率的选择。
可以理解的是,所述运行在笔记本电脑中的快捷程序模块可以是固化在芯片中的软件;所述芯片可以是现有笔记本电脑中的器件,也可以是在现有的笔记本电脑中的基础上增加的器件。当然,该快捷程序模块也可以采用硬件的形式来实现。
下面已具体的实施例进一步来说明本发明。
笔记本电脑的触控板配置为NV公司的NV-44m独立触控板。触控板在默认情况下的核心采样速率是200报告/秒。事实上采样速率只要在200报告/秒时,就能爽快的打游戏,比如CS。而在做文档操作时只需要60报告/秒就能达到良好的效果。快捷程序模块在这两种典型状态下所需的采样速率和最需要强调性能的最高200报告/秒的采样速率之间进行快速的切换。
本实例中的切换方式采用的是键盘上的特殊按键发出组合键码调用切换功能(或模式切换按键)。从该实施例中可知,如果采样速率从“200报告/秒速率”切换到“60报告/秒速率”本发明的切换步骤和现有技术的切换步骤分别详见图1和图6,从图1和图6的实现步骤可以看到本发明中用户需要进行的操作大大的减小,从原有的6个步骤减少到只需要2个步骤,而且由于采用了按键切换,用户可以在看不到或看不清楚显示的情况下完成全部的切换动作。最重要的是还可以大大方便用户随心操作,满足笔记本电脑的移动性和用户的需要。
综上所述,本发明通过快捷键调用触控板的驱动,对触控板采样速率的调整,达到笔记本电脑在不同工作环境下的触控板采样速率的快捷切换,将采样速率调整用户所需的最佳状态,以满足客户的在不同环境下对触控板采样速率的不同要求,并且,如果仅针对某特定的采样速率之间的切换,可以通过快捷键一步完成切换。
以上所述仅是本发明的优选实施方式,应当指出,对于本技术领域的普通技术人员来说,在不脱离本发明原理的前提下,还可以做出若干改进和润饰,这些改进和润饰也应视为本发明的保护范围。
权利要求
1.一种切换触控板采样速率的方法,其特征在于,包括以下步骤A、存储可供用户选择的触控板的采样速率;B、检测触控板所能支持的所有采样速率;C、接收用户对触控板的采样速率进行选择,并输入选择信息;D、对用户选择的触控板的采样速率与当前触控板所支持的采样速率进行比较,如果能够支持用户的选择,则进入步骤E;否则,则输出当前触控板的采样速率,并返回步骤C;E、根据选定触控板的采样速率,调整触控板的相关属性;F、返回调整后的信息,完成触控板采样速率的切换。
2.根据权利要求1所述切换触控板采样速率的方法,其特征在于,所述步骤B中结合触控板的驱动、接口以及底层驱动,识别触控板参数,来检测触控板所能支持的所有采样速率;所述步骤E中通过调用触控板驱动,修改参数值来调整触控板的相关属性;所述步骤E中通过底层驱动识别,将所述调整后的信息反馈到系统。
3.根据权利要求1所述切换触控板采样速率的方法,其特征在于,所述步骤C中接收用户通过点击采样速率下拉菜单产生的输入信息或者是通过快捷键发送的选择指令来接收用户对触控板的采样速率。
4.根据权利要求1至3任一项所述切换触控板采样速率的方法,其特征在于,步骤B还包括接收用户启动采样速率调节的信息,显示供用户选择的采样速率。
5.根据权利要求4所述切换触控板采样速率的方法,其特征在于,接收用户使用快捷键通过嵌入式控制器发出的扫描码来启动采样速率调节的信息。
6.根据权利要求4所述切换触控板采样速率的方法,其特征在于,所述显示供用户选择的采样速率的显示过程包括比较所述存储的采样速率和当前触控板所支持的采样速率,显示出允许调节的采样速率。
7.一种切换触控板采样速率的装置,包括用户信息接收单元,用于接收用户启动采样速率调节过程的信息和用户选择采样速率的信息;采样速率识别单元,与用户信息接收单元相连,用于获取当前触控板驱动支持的采样数率;调整信息返回单元,用于向系统返回选定的触控板的采样速率;其特征在于,还包括采样速率存储单元,用于存储可供用户选择使用的触控板采样速率状态;采样速率显示单元,与用户信息接收单元和采样速率存储单元分别相连,用于显示供用户选择的触控板的采样速率;采样速率比较单元,与用户信息接收单元相连,用于对用户选择的采样速率与触控板能够支持的采样速率进行比较;采样速率调整单元,与采样速率比较单元和调整信息返回单元分别相连,用于在选定的触控板的采样速率下,调节触控板的工作属性。
8.根据权利要求7所述切换触控板采样速率的装置,其特征在于,所述采样速率存储单元、采样速率显示单元、采样速率比较单元、采样速率调整单元是分立的器件;或者至少两个单元集成在一起。
9.根据权利要求7或8所述切换触控板采样速率的装置,其特征在于,所述采样速率存储单元、采样速率显示单元、采样速率比较单元、采样速率调整单元是内含固化软件的芯片,或者是运行在笔记本电脑的软件模块。
10.根据权利要求9所述切换触控板采样速率的装置,其特征在于,所述用户信息接收单元是嵌入式控制器;所述采样速率识别单元包括触控板驱动;所述调整信息返回单元是底层驱动。
全文摘要
本发明涉及一种切换触控板采样速率的方法及装置,所述方法包括A.存储可供用户选择触控板的采样速率;B.检测触控板所能支持所有采样速率;C.接收用户对触控板采样速率进行选择;D.对用户选择触控板的采样速率与当前触控板所支持的采样速率进行比较,如果支持用户的选择,则进入步骤E;否则,输出当前触控板采样速率,并返回步骤C;E.根据选定触控板采样速率,调整触控板的相关属性;F.返回调整后的信息,完成触控板采样速率的切换。所述装置包括用户信息接收单元、采样速率识别单元、调整信息返回单元、采样速率存储单元、采样速率显示单元;采样速率比较单元、采样速率调整单元。本发明实现简单,方便用户调节触控板采样速率。
文档编号G06F3/033GK1889022SQ20051008021
公开日2007年1月3日 申请日期2005年6月28日 优先权日2005年6月28日
发明者梅磊 申请人:联想(北京)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1